I dropped a household item onto my keyboard. All is Ok except that the
Start/Menu Task Bar has moved from the bottom of the desktop and is now along
the top of the screen. What have I done, and how can I move it back to its
rightful place? Thank you
 
Hi Tim, to move the task bar back to it original place, right click the task
bar and make sure the task bar is unlocked.if its unlocked click and drag the
taskbar until its moved to the desired position, then right click the task
bar and lock the task bar again.

There is no rightful place. The taskbar can be on any side of the screen.
It just depends on how you like to work. By default it's at the bottom.
Just drag it. Right click an empty area of the taskbar and unlock the
taskbar if it's locked. Then right click on a blank area of the taskbar,
hold it down and drag it to the bottom of the screen. Then go back and lock
the taskbar.
